Agent's Description

Situated in the plain, at the end of a small and pretty village, the property proposes a 1-storied house with 87 sq. m. living area, a garden spread on the area of 580 sq. m., a basement vast 10 sq. m. and a garage for two cars. Additionally there is a summer kitchen which accommodates a corridor and one room which gives an extra space and is of great convenience. The village is 8 km. away from a town which is a municipality and 46 km. away from the town of Plovdiv.

  • Ground floor: A glazed entrance hall, a corridor, two rooms and a cellar are nicely arranged on the area of the floor. Additionally there is a summer kitchen. The property is supplied with electricity, running water inside and outside the house, a telephone line and a septic tank.

The garden is planted with fruit trees- pears, peaches and almond trees. An outbuilding and a sheltered place, as well as a parking lot are available in it.

The house is structurally sound, made of bricks and stone. It is in a good condition but a refreshment of the rooms and a compartment inside has to be converted into an internal bathroom/ WC. Some inner transformations are also possible, according to the clients’ taste.

This property will give you the chance to experience the charm of rural life and to live in a nice village where local shops, cafes and a swimming pool are available.

Bratsigovo

The village is situated in Southern Bulgaria. It is located in the Foothills of the Rodope Mountains on the banks of the Umishka River, and is close to the towns of Peshtera and Krichim. Historical records show the township was established at some point in the 16th century, built over the ruins of an earlier settlement. Archaeological evidence has shown that the area was inhabited by Thracians and later Slavs. The town is developing as a balneological center, too. There is a cold mineral water spring (18-26 C) with the flow rate of 120 litres per minute at the distance of 500 metres west of it. There is a balneo-sanatorium built up here. The mineral water treats some skin diseases, the nervous system, kidney related diseases and others. There is a nice park and a country-houses zone around it.

The Antique Teatre in Plovdiv

The Antique Theatre is one of the most famous monuments in Bulgaria. It was built in the beginning of the 2nd century during the reign of the Roman Emperor Trajan. It is situated in the natural saddle between the Dzhambaz Tepe and Taksim Tepe hills. It is divided into two parts with 14 rows each divided with a horizontal lane. The theatre could accommodate 3,500 people. The three-storey scene is located on the southern part and is decorated with frezes, cornices and statues. The theatre was studied, conserved and restored between 1968 and 1984. Many events are still held on the scene including the Verdi festival and the International Folklore festival.

The old town in Plovdiv

Currently, Plovdiv is a modern city with an ancient spirit and charm, emanating from its numerous remains of old times. No doubt the biggest sight of Plovdiv is The Old Town. The Old Town is declared an archaeological reserve and covers the three-hill area where the town was located originally. Almost all historical sights of Plovdiv can be found there – religious sanctuaries, old residential and public buildings, archeological monuments and museums, fortress walls and narrow cobbled streets.
